2022-06-19 23:45:28 +00:00
|
|
|
services:
|
|
|
|
runner:
|
|
|
|
build:
|
|
|
|
context: ..
|
|
|
|
dockerfile: .docker/runner/Dockerfile
|
2022-06-25 12:12:55 +00:00
|
|
|
target: dev
|
2022-06-25 17:51:52 +00:00
|
|
|
args:
|
|
|
|
- DGID=${DGID}
|
2022-06-19 23:45:28 +00:00
|
|
|
image: dockermc
|
2022-06-25 12:12:55 +00:00
|
|
|
environment:
|
|
|
|
- MC_VERSION=1.19
|
2022-06-25 17:51:52 +00:00
|
|
|
- DGID=${DGID}
|
2022-06-25 12:12:55 +00:00
|
|
|
volumes:
|
|
|
|
- ../src:/src
|
2022-06-25 17:51:52 +00:00
|
|
|
- dockermc:/mcserver
|
|
|
|
- ./docker-compose.server.yml:/docker-compose.server.yml
|
|
|
|
- /var/run/docker.sock:/var/run/docker.sock
|
|
|
|
container_name: dockermc-runner
|
2022-07-03 22:00:04 +00:00
|
|
|
networks:
|
|
|
|
dockermc:
|
|
|
|
aliases:
|
|
|
|
- runner
|
2022-06-25 17:51:52 +00:00
|
|
|
volumes:
|
|
|
|
dockermc:
|
|
|
|
name: dockermc
|
|
|
|
driver: local
|
|
|
|
driver_opts:
|
|
|
|
type: none
|
|
|
|
o: bind
|
2022-07-03 22:00:04 +00:00
|
|
|
device: $PWD/mcserver
|
|
|
|
networks:
|
|
|
|
dockermc:
|
|
|
|
name: dockermc
|
|
|
|
driver: bridge
|